How courts have described this case
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.
- holding that Paramount’s per se rule only applies to cases in which the mortgagor’s testimony is rebutted by a certificate of acknowledgement

- recognizing that “every opinion in which [O.R.C. § 5301.234]has been considered” has found that statute should be applied prospectively only
